The amplitude of free vibrations of the body is 0.5 m. what path this body has traveled in three periods of vibration.

To calculate the path traversed by a conditional oscillating body, we apply the formula: S = 4A * N.

Variables: A – amplitude of free vibrations of a conventional body (A = 0.5 m); N is the number of oscillations over 3 periods (N = 3 oscillations).

Calculation: S = 4A * N = 4 * 0.5 * 3 = 6 m.

Answer: For three periods of oscillation, the conditional body will travel a path of 6 m.
